Ralph Anderson1 ABSTRACT.—Patterns of mineral nutrient uptake and distribution within the roots, stems, and leaves of Artemisia pyg- maea and in the vascular parasite Orobanche fasciculata were investigated. All nutrients studied were magnified over concentrations found in the soil into the host and parasite. Nitrogen, phosphorus, potassium, and zinc were magnified along the flow gradient of soil-roots-stems-leaves of the host.
